The phrase (The Real Wolf’s Howl) serves as both a literal natural phenomenon and a profound cultural symbol within Turkic traditions. It represents more than just a sound; it is a signal of communication, a symbol of national identity, and a spiritual call to action. 1. The Biological Reality: A Tool for Survival
In the wild, a "real" wolf's howl is a sophisticated biological tool. Far from the myth of howling at the moon, wolves howl primarily for communication within their pack or with rival groups.
